算法推荐服务器提供什么

worktile 其他 23

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    算法推荐服务器是一种能够根据用户的喜好和需求,提供个性化、精准推荐的服务器。它通过分析用户行为数据、用户属性数据和物品属性数据等多种数据来源,运用一系列算法模型来进行计算和预测,从而推荐用户可能感兴趣的物品或内容。下面将从功能、优势和适用场景三个方面介绍算法推荐服务器提供的内容。

    一、功能
    算法推荐服务器能够提供以下内容:

    1. 个性化推荐:根据用户的历史浏览记录、购买记录、评价等数据,为用户推荐与其兴趣相关的物品或内容。
    2. 实时推荐:根据用户当前的行为、环境等因素,实时地向用户推荐适合的物品或内容,提升用户体验。
    3. 混合推荐:通过结合不同的推荐算法,将基于内容的推荐、协同过滤推荐等多种推荐方式进行综合,提供更加准确和全面的推荐结果。
    4. 排序和过滤:对推荐结果进行排序和过滤,确保用户看到的内容是最符合其兴趣和需求的。

    二、优势
    算法推荐服务器相比传统的内容推荐方式具有以下优势:

    1. 精准性:通过分析大量的用户数据和物品数据,采用复杂的算法模型进行计算和预测,能够更准确地推荐用户感兴趣的内容。
    2. 个性化:根据用户的历史行为和兴趣,为每个用户定制独特的推荐结果,提供更符合个人口味和需求的内容。
    3. 实时性:能够随时根据用户当前的行为和环境变化,实时地调整和更新推荐内容,确保用户获得最新、最适合的推荐结果。
    4. 自动化:算法推荐服务器能够自动地进行数据分析和计算,无需人工干预,大大提高了推荐效率和准确率。
    5. 可扩展性:算法推荐服务器具有良好的可扩展性,可以应对大规模用户和物品数据,支持高并发的推荐请求。

    三、适用场景
    算法推荐服务器广泛应用于以下场景:

    1. 电商平台:为用户推荐个性化的商品、促销活动等,提高用户购买转化率和用户满意度。
    2. 视频流媒体平台:根据用户的观看历史、评分等数据,为用户推荐相关电影、电视剧、综艺节目等,增强用户粘性。
    3. 音乐流媒体平台:根据用户的听歌历史、收藏歌单等数据,为用户推荐相似风格的音乐和歌手,提升用户体验。
    4. 新闻资讯平台:根据用户的浏览历史、关注领域等数据,为用户推荐符合其兴趣的新闻报道和文章,增加用户阅读时长。

    总之,算法推荐服务器能够根据用户的个人兴趣和需求,提供个性化、精准的推荐内容,广泛应用于电商、娱乐、新闻等领域,帮助企业提升用户体验和市场竞争力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    算法推荐服务器应该提供以下几点:

    1. 推荐算法支持:算法推荐服务器应该提供相应的推荐算法支持,包括常见的协同过滤算法、内容基推荐算法、深度学习推荐算法等。服务器应该具备对大规模数据进行快速处理的能力,并提供高效的推荐结果生成。

    2. 数据存储和处理能力:算法推荐服务器应该具备强大的数据存储和处理能力,能够存储和处理大规模的用户和物品数据。这包括支持并行处理和分布式计算,以提高系统的响应速度和并发能力。

    3. 实时推荐能力:现在很多应用要求能够实时地根据用户的行为和兴趣生成实时推荐结果,因此算法推荐服务器应该具备实时推荐的能力。这包括实时数据处理和实时计算,以及能够快速生成实时推荐结果的算法。

    4. 个性化推荐能力:个性化推荐是算法推荐服务器的核心功能之一。算法推荐服务器应该能够根据用户的历史行为和兴趣,为用户提供个性化的推荐结果。这包括用户画像的建立和更新,以及基于用户画像和兴趣模型的推荐算法。

    5. 系统性能监控和优化:算法推荐服务器应该提供系统性能监控和优化的功能。这包括对系统各个组件的性能监控、异常检测和故障处理,以及对系统的性能进行优化,提高系统的吞吐量和响应速度。

    总之,算法推荐服务器应该提供强大的数据存储和处理能力、支持多种推荐算法、具备实时和个性化推荐能力,并能对系统进行性能监控和优化,以提供高效、准确和个性化的推荐服务。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    当设计和实现一个算法推荐服务器时,需要提供以下内容:

    1. 推荐算法模型:算法推荐服务器的核心就是推荐算法模型。根据不同的业务场景和需求,可以选择合适的推荐算法模型,例如基于协同过滤的推荐、基于内容的推荐、基于深度学习的推荐等。在服务器中需要提供这些模型的实现,并提供相应的接口供外部调用。

    2. 数据采集和预处理:为了训练和更新推荐算法模型,服务器需要能够实时采集和处理用户行为数据。这包括用户的浏览历史、购买记录、评分和评论等信息。服务器需要提供相应的数据采集和处理逻辑,将原始数据转化为算法所需的特征表示。

    3. 模型训练和更新:推荐算法模型是需要不断优化和更新的。服务器需要提供相应的训练和更新接口,可以定期对模型进行离线训练,也可以根据实时数据进行在线训练。训练过程中可能涉及到特征工程、模型选择、参数调优等步骤,服务器需要提供相应的功能来支持这些操作。

    4. 推荐结果生成和排序:推荐算法服务器需要将推荐结果返回给用户。根据业务需求,可以生成不同的推荐结果,例如 Top N 推荐、个性化推荐、实时推荐等。服务器需要提供相应的结果生成和排序逻辑,以保证用户得到最优的推荐结果。

    5. 用户画像管理:为了更好地理解用户需求和行为,服务器需要建立和维护用户画像。通过分析和挖掘用户的属性,兴趣等信息,可以更加精准地进行推荐。服务器需要提供用户画像的管理功能,包括用户特征提取、用户标签管理、用户兴趣模型等。

    6. 高并发和负载均衡:推荐服务器需要处理大量的请求,并且需要保证高可用性和高性能。服务器需要支持高并发和负载均衡,可以通过横向扩展来实现高并发处理能力,使用负载均衡来分发请求到不同的服务器节点上。

    7. 监控和日志:为了及时发现和排查问题,服务器需要提供监控和日志功能。通过监控服务的性能指标,可以及时发现和解决问题。通过日志记录服务的运行状态和异常情况,可以排查问题的原因和进行问题分析。

    8. 安全与权限管理:推荐服务器处理的是用户的个人信息和推荐结果,在设计时需要考虑安全和权限管理。服务器需要提供相应的安全措施,例如数据加密、身份验证、访问控制等,以保护用户的隐私和数据安全。

    总之,一个高效和可靠的算法推荐服务器需要涵盖上述内容,通过合理的架构和设计,确保推荐系统的性能和用户体验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部